PROCEDURE
实验过程
As shown in FIG. 4—step v, to a solution of compound 1019 (31.7 mg, 0.100 mmol) in DME (0.50 mL) was added a nucleophilic amine (pyrrolidine, 10 μL, 0.11 mmol) and diisopropylethylamine (25.8 mg, 34.8 μL, 0.200 mmol). The mixture was heated at 160° C. with microwave for 5 min, followed by the addition of 5-(4,4,5,5-tetramethyl-[1,3,2]dioxaborolan-2-yl)-7H-pyrrolo[2,3-d]pyrimidine (compound 1005, 39.9 mg, 0.100 mmol) and a solution of CsF (30 mg, 0.20 mmol) in water (0.25 mL). The mixture was heated at 160° C. with microwave for 5 min. The reaction mixture was filtered through a short pad of silica gel using EtOAc/hexanes as eluent to provide, after concentration in vacuo, the crude intermediate tosylate. This intermediate was dissolved in 1 mL of dry methanol and 200 uL of 25% sodium methoxide in methanol was added. The reaction mixture was stirred at 60° C. for 1 hour and quenched with trifluoroacetic acid. Purification by reversed-phase HPLC gave 35.0 mg of 2-[4-pyrrolidin-1-yl-6-(7H-pyrrolo[2,3-d]pyrimidin-5-yl)-pyrimidin-2-ylamino]-N-(2,2,2-trifluoro-ethyl)-propionamide TFA salt (a compound of formula IX where R10 is 1-pyrrolidine).
